Full Job Description
We are seeking a Cook (Homemaker) to join our Catering and Domestic team on a part-time (0.93 FTE) employed basis. The post-holder will be responsible for ensuring that children and young people live in a homely environment including the cooking of high quality and nutritious food.
Homemakers are required to have an ability to produce consistently excellent and nutritional lunches and evening meals for our children. You will understand the central role that outstanding food preparation has on creating a homely environment within the residential cottage. You will be required to undertake some domestic duties and ensure a high standard of cleanliness. An elementary food hygiene certificate, or higher, is an essential requirement. A qualification in cooking or food preparation is highly desirable, however, training may be provided for the successful candidate.
The successful candidate will work 32.5 hours per week (0.93 FTE) excluding meal breaks, Monday to Friday, 11am-6pm or 8am-3pm. There may be opportunities to work additional shifts.
The salary for the post is £23,909 per annum (£14.15 per hour), calculated on the basis of a full-time equivalent salary of £25,748.
The successful applicant will be required to join Disclosure Scotland’s Protecting Vulnerable Groups (PVG) Scheme.
Harmeny Education Trust is a charitable organisation providing therapeutic care and education to children who have experienced early years trauma through abuse, neglect and family disruption, referred from all over Scotland. We currently work with children and young people aged 5-18, both on a day and all-year-round residential basis.
Harmeny is situated in a beautiful 35-acre woodland estate, which includes residential and education accommodation, community garden, orchard, wildlife habitats and children’s play areas. Harmeny is located in Balerno on the outskirts of Edinburgh, at the foot of the Pentland Hills; we are easily accessible by bus and there is on-site parking available.
